Bestkaam Logo
Fancall Private Limited Logo

iOS Developer (Swift)

Ahmedabad, Gujarat, India

1 month ago

Applicants: 0

Salary Not Disclosed

N/A

Job Description

About The Role Job Description ? iOS Developer (Swift) We are looking for a talented iOS Developer (Swift) to join our mobile team. You will be responsible for building robust, scalable, and user-friendly iOS applications with advanced features like video calling, real-time chat, push notifications, and payment gateway integration. Responsibilities Design, build, and maintain iOS applications using Swift / UIKit. Implement real-time communication using WebSockets / Socket.IO. Integrate video calling SDKs (Agora, WebRTC, Jitsi, Twilio, etc.). Work with Apple Push Notification Service (APNS) and Firebase (FCM). Integrate payment gateways (Apple Pay, Razorpay, Stripe, PayPal, UPI, etc.). Work with REST/GraphQL APIs and manage local storage with CoreData / Realm / SQLite. Ensure app performance, responsiveness, and security. Write clean, maintainable, and testable code following MVVM/MVC patterns. Collaborate closely with backend, design, and product teams. Debug, optimise, and continuously improve app quality. Requirements 2?5 years of iOS development experience. Strong knowledge of Swift, UIKit, and SwiftUI. Experience with real-time sockets (Socket.IO/WebSockets). Hands-on experience with video calling SDKs (Agora, WebRTC, etc.). Solid understanding of APNS and Firebase push notifications. Experience with payment gateway integrations (Apple Pay, Razorpay, Stripe, etc.). Familiarity with Dependency Injection, Combine, async/await, and concurrency. Strong understanding of app security (Keychain, SSL pinning, data encryption). Experience with Git, CI/CD pipelines, and App Store submission process. Good to Have Experience with modular architectures and Clean Architecture. Knowledge of Swift Package Manager, Cocoapods, and Carthage. Familiarity with Unit Testing & UI Testing (XCTest, XCUITest). Previous experience working on consumer apps at scale. Skills: swift,design,pay,apple,firebase,gateway,ios,app,io,video

Additional Information

Company Name
Fancall Private Limited
Industry
N/A
Department
N/A
Role Category
Software Engineer
Job Role
Mid-Senior level
Education
No Restriction
Job Types
On Site
Gender
No Restriction
Notice Period
Less Than 30 Days
Year of Experience
1 - Any Yrs
Job Posted On
1 month ago
Application Ends
N/A

Similar Jobs

Capgemini

1 month ago

Android Developer

Capgemini

Accenture in India

3 weeks ago

Application Developer

Accenture in India

Mastercard

1 month ago

Software Engineer II

Mastercard

Sia

1 month ago

DevOps Engineer

Sia

People Prime Worldwide

4 weeks ago

Python Developer

People Prime Worldwide

Turbostart

1 month ago

Salesforce Developer

Turbostart

Accenture in India

1 month ago

Application Developer

Accenture in India

WebileApps (India) Pvt. Ltd. (A KFin Technologies company)

1 month ago

Software Engineer

WebileApps (India) Pvt. Ltd. (A KFin Technologies company)

Appeneure

1 month ago

React Native Developer Intern

Appeneure

SII Group India

1 month ago

Senior Full Stack Engineer(NestJS,Typescript)

SII Group India